Skip to content

E-Commerce-WebSite-Rest-Api is a Java-based web application with user and admin features for browsing and purchasing products, managing orders, and user accounts. It utilizes Java, Spring Boot, Spring Security, MySQL, and J-Unit.

Notifications You must be signed in to change notification settings

rajshekar11/E-Commerce-WebSite-Rest-Api

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 

Repository files navigation

E-Commerce-WebSite-Rest-Api

User side features

  • Search by category
  • Sort, Filter by rating, price
  • See individual product page
  • Add to cart
  • See cart details and total price in it
  • Make a purchase, and track status
  • See historical order
  • Payment ,Checkout pages
  • Login, Register Pages

Admin Side Features

  • Product List
  • Add new products
  • Manage Quantities
  • Order management
  • See orders, details of orders
  • Update status ( Processed, Failed, To be dispatched, out for delivery, returned )
  • Search by user details ( phone, email, name, id )
  • Search by order
  • Orders which are cancelled or refunded
  • Refund requests
  • User management
  • See users, and details
  • admin and users ( different login )

Teach Stacks Used

  • Java
  • Spring framework
  • Spring Boot Data JPA
  • Spring Security
  • Hibernate
  • Maven
  • MySQL
  • Swagger

About

E-Commerce-WebSite-Rest-Api is a Java-based web application with user and admin features for browsing and purchasing products, managing orders, and user accounts. It utilizes Java, Spring Boot, Spring Security, MySQL, and J-Unit.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published